Summary:In this paper, we deal with nonlinear iterative integro-functional differential equations (IIFDEs) of first order. We study the uniqueness of solutions and Ulam stabilities regarding that the IIFDEs. The new results in relation to the uniqueness of solutions and Ulam stabilities of the IIFDEs are achieved according to the Banach’s fixed point theorem. The consequences of this paper have scientific novelties and provide new contributions to the subjects of the uniqueness of solutions and the Ulam stabilities of IIFDEs.
